In Moldova’s evolving infrastructure landscape, polyethylene (HDPE) pipe welding machines play a critical role in modernizing water distribution, expanding rural gas networks, and supporting irrigation systems for agriculture. Choosing reliable welding equipment helps local contractors, municipal utilities, and project owners deliver long-lasting joints that withstand Moldova’s cold winters and freeze-thaw cycles.
Why Moldova Needs Reliable HDPE Welding Solutions
Moldova faces a mix of urban renovation projects and rural expansion programs funded by international donors and EU partners. Aging cast-iron and metal pipelines are increasingly replaced with HDPE for its corrosion resistance and flexibility. For local engineers and installers, the right butt fusion or electrofusion machines mean faster installation, fewer leaks, and lower lifetime maintenance costs.
Key Local Drivers
Municipal water authorities, private contractors, and agricultural cooperatives prioritize equipment that performs under seasonal temperature changes and in remote locations with limited workshop facilities. Portability, durable hydraulics, and easy-to-follow controls are high on the list for Moldovan projects where on-site conditions vary widely.

Types of Welding Machines Suitable for Moldovan Projects
Different project scales require different machines: hand-held or manual units for small repairs and rural works; hydraulic machines for medium pipelines in town networks; and CNC automatic butt fusion units for high-volume or large-diameter installations. Multi-angle fitting machines are increasingly used where complex connections and fittings are required for irrigation and industrial lines.
Performance Considerations
Look for machines that provide consistent heating, precise alignment, and documented weld records. In Moldova, ease of maintenance and access to spare parts can dramatically reduce downtime on contracts that are time-sensitive or weather-dependent.
Comparison Table — Common Models & Best Uses
| Model | Type | Pipe Range | Best For | Key Feature |
|---|---|---|---|---|
| Manual Butt Fusion | Manual | 63–400 mm | Rural repairs, small contractors | Lightweight, easy transport |
| Hydraulic Butt Fusion | Hydraulic | 160–1600 mm | Municipal networks, contractors | Stable pressure control for reliable joints |
| Automatic/CNC Butt Fusion | Automatic | 50–630 mm+ | Large projects, record-keeping | Weld log export and precise control |
Why After-Sales and Training Matter in Moldova
Training local crews in correct fusion procedures reduces rework and ensures compliance with international standards. For many Moldovan municipalities and private firms, supplier-led training, accessible documentation in local languages (Romanian/Russian), and a reliable spare parts channel are deciding factors when selecting a manufacturer.

Customization & Practical Tips
Projects in Moldova often require custom clamping solutions, site-adapted frames for uneven terrain, and multi-angle fittings for irrigation networks. Ask suppliers about modular options that allow upgrades from manual to hydraulic or automated controls as project needs grow.
Selecting a Trusted Manufacturer
Evaluate suppliers based on documented weld quality, local references, warranty terms, and the availability of technical support within the Eastern Europe region. Competitive pricing matters, but total cost of ownership — including training and spare parts delivery times to Moldova — is the true benchmark.
